An important aspect of investing in agricultural land in Cluj is understanding its geographical and economic landscape. Nestled between the Apuseni Mountains and the plains of Transylvania, Cluj-Napoca benefits from fertile soil suitable for a wide range of crops. The climate in the region, characterized by warm summers and cold winters, supports both traditional and innovative farming methods. This makes it an attractive location for both agricultural production and real estate development aimed at agri-tourism or sustainable farming practices.

The demand for agricultural land off market in Cluj is bolstered by the city’s rapid urbanization. As Cluj-Napoca continues to expand, the pressure on surrounding agricultural zones increases, leading to appreciation in land value. Investors seeking agricultural properties off the conventional market can often find opportunities through local networks and connections within the region. This approach can yield significant advantages, as off-market deals can sometimes offer better terms and less competition than traditional listings.

Another key consideration for investors is the local economy and market trends. Cluj boasts a vibrant economy driven by its IT sector, academia, and a growing number of multinational companies establishing offices in the area. This urban growth directly impacts agricultural land demand, as the need for sustainable food sources increases alongside population growth. Moreover, Cluj’s strategic positioning allows for easy access to other major cities and markets in Romania and neighboring countries, further enhancing its appeal for agricultural investments.

Investing in off-market agricultural land in Cluj also allows for strategic positioning in the context of Romania’s agricultural policies. As Romania continues to integrate more closely with the European Union’s agricultural framework, investments in this sector can benefit from various subsidies, grants, and incentives aimed at boosting agricultural production and sustainability. This favorable policy environment presents an enticing opportunity for foreign investors looking to make their mark in the Romanian agricultural sector.

When considering investment potential, it is also important to conduct thorough due diligence. Analyzing soil quality, water availability, and zoning regulations is crucial for ensuring the long-term viability of agricultural land. Additionally, assessing the local agricultural market, including competition, crop profitability, and access to markets, can aid in making informed investment decisions. Engaging with local agricultural experts or consultants can provide insights into the best practices for managing and developing agricultural properties in Cluj.

Despite the opportunities, it is essential to remain aware of the challenges associated with agricultural land investments in this region. Issues such as fluctuating market prices, dependency on climate conditions, and potential regulatory changes can impact profitability. However, with proper planning and risk management strategies, investors can navigate these hurdles effectively.
